Highlights
Are people in Wake Forest older or younger than people in Waunakee?
- The Median Age in Wake Forest is 0.4 years younger than in Waunakee.

Are housing costs cheaper in Wake Forest or Waunakee?
- Wake Forest housing costs are 2.0% more expensive than Waunakee hous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Wake Forest or Waunakee?
- The average commute for residents of Wake Forest is 6.4 minutes longer than it is for residents of Waunakee.

Things to do in Waunakee?
Waunakee, WI is a lively village north of Madison full of breathtaking views like Tower Hill Park and exciting activities such as water sports at Pheasant Branch Conservancy; local cultures are blended together in the city with festivals like Waunafest celebrating art and music.

Things to do in Wake Forest?
Wake Forest, North Carolina is located in Wake County and provides a wide range of both recreational and nightlife options from the Heritage Golf Club to Main Street Social Bar & Grill.
